Subject: Scheduled key rotation — Gatepulse turnstile counter

Hi on-call,

As part of this quarter's credential hygiene sweep, we are rotating the key the Gatepulse turnstile counter uses to push entry tallies to the Crestfield aggregation service. The old key will be revoked at 06:00 Thursday, before gates open at Bramley Arena. Please update the counter's config on both edge boxes, restart the collector, and verify tallies appear within five minutes. If anything looks off, roll back and page the platform team. The replacement key is below.

API key for yahig-tadup: kto7_ubizbYm

# Regional Sales Review — Northbray Territory (Managers Only)

This page summarises the half-year sales review for the Northbray region conducted by Halvett Industries. Bookings reached 92% of plan, with the Larkfen product family outperforming and the Dunmore accounts lagging. Commercial lead Petra Ilsen attributes the gap to delayed channel onboarding. Corrective actions include revised quota splits and a joint campaign with the Westvale team in Q4. Heads of department should review the restricted planning note appended directly below.

board note of bawep-tajef: Queniusek Systems plans to raise the Quenvan list price by 53.1 percent in March. The pricing group signed off on a budget of $176.4 million for Project Drueth. The renewal with Casionix Partners closes at $142.5 million a year, 8.3 percent below the last contract. Project Fraax slips by six weeks because of the tooling delay.

Ticket: Staging env misconfigured for Siftgate bloom filter

The bloom layer in front of the Pellet KV store is rejecting all lookups in staging because the env file was copied from the dev template without credentials. False-positive tuning values are fine; only the auth line is missing. To unblock the weekly demo, the Pellet admission secret must be set on the following line.

env line for yaguf-fajop: LEDGER_TOKEN13=fb08984397349

## Env vars for the Ormshed refactor

We are migrating the legacy Quillbase ORM layer to the new repository pattern. During the transition, both code paths read the same env file. Keep variable names stable; the shim maps old names automatically. Connection pooling is configured via QUILL_POOL_SIZE. The legacy layer also needs the database credential, which is set on the line directly below.

vault entry, yahif-yajep: COURIER_KEY29=b802bdf8034096b65a51c6ba5abe2